MEET OXFAM
Oxfam, A global community that is based on the idea that it is possible to design a world that is better, kinder and more fair, a world in which every person can not only live, but also flourish. Oxfam is an international non-governmental organisation. Oxfam’s vision is to ensure that the root causes of poverty are erased and are no longer perpetuated. Their mission is based on the understanding that poverty is not an inevitable condition that people have to live in.
Oxfam empowers communities and individuals to tackle the root causes of poverty including resource distribution injustices, exclusion, and abuse of human rights. They do this mainly through lobbying, charity and community upliftment. Through such concerns as gender, climate, wages and education Oxfam envisions a world where no one will be constrained by poverty and every person will be able to have a better deserving life.

Tackling climate change
The decrease of emissions is simply one aspect of climate change mitigation at this point. The issue of climate change also raises the topic of equality, as well as the fact that the countries and people that have contributed the least to the creation of this crisis are going to bear a disproportionate amount of the bad consequences.
These places are particularly susceptible because they are confronted with issues such as rising sea levels, an increase in the severity and frequency of natural catastrophes, and a lack of food security. In addition to this, they are unable to gather the necessary resources in order to appropriately handle climate change difficulties.
The aim of Oxfam to make sure that the voices of those who are experiencing the most severe effects of climate change are heard and that the resources that are available to assist them in not only surviving but also thriving in the face of an uncertain future are made available to them. It is possible to develop communities that are robust and economically stable, ready to meet future climatic problems, and, as a result, create a better world for future generations.

Women’s rights and gender justice
Recognising that women – especially poor women – have the power to drive change, Oxfam places gender justice and women’s rights at the heart of their mission. Oxfam empowers women to lead change and fight for policies and laws that limit them by advocating for equal wages, job safety, and a means to be heard. Oxfam aims at ensuring women’s safety, fulfilling their needs and demanding gender-sensitive approaches to disaster relief to enable disaster relief in a way that is distinct for women.
Apart from ensuring that women’s basic needs are met in situations of conflict, natural disasters, violence or other forms of injustice, Oxfam empowers women economically by availing capital, seeds, tools and other necessities that women need to begin and sustain their businesses. To address the issue of inequality, Oxfam stands with women and funds women’s organizations at the base, and reallocate funds to women who are excluded, including Black, Indigenous and People of Colour, queer, trans, and migrant women.

OXFAM DURING EMERGENCIES
It is during emergency that Oxfam has one of the most crucial responsibilities of addressing some of the world’s most pressing needs. In disasters in form of floods, earthquakes and droughts or in conflict situations, Oxfam is there providing emergency aid that can make the difference between life and death. They ensure that the most affected people get clean water, food, hygiene products, and emergency shelter especially to the vulnerable groups as they are always the most affected.
However, Oxfam’s role does not end at the provision of help to those in distress. They are a long-term partner, helping communities recover and rebuild after disasters. Whether it is about reconstructing major structures or reconstructing people’s means of living, they work with local stakeholders and the people to offer solutions that are sustainable.
To this end, Oxfam aims at helping people achieve a better recovery in terms of financial support to families to help them get back on their feet, improvement of sanitation, or rebuilding homes.
